Circulation schematic diagram of plate heat exchanger
Plate heat exchanger is a high efficiency heat exchanger which is made of a series of corrugated sheet metal stacked. The structure of plate heat exchanger mainly consists of plate, gasket, pressing plate (movable plate, fixed plate) ,carrying bar, guide bar and front support column and so on.
The plates are sealed by sealing gasket. The two fluid channels are separated, the cold and heat transfer medium flow through their respective channels, and the heat exchange is carried out with the separated plates, so as to achieve the required temperature.
The plates are all open in the corners, and then assembled together to form a plate pack to form a distribution pipe and a collecting pipe. After the heat exchange of cold / hot medium, the flow from each collecting pipe is recycled.
The plate heat exchanger is mainly inter wall heat transfer. The main feature of the wall heat exchanger is cold. The two hot fluids are separated by a solid wall, such as a plate, and the two cannot be mixed, and heat exchange is carried out through the wall.
The single flow structure of plate heat exchanger is that only two plates do not heat transfer, the first plate and the end plate. Double flow structure: each process has 2 plates without heat transfer.
